Hazel Stewart Obituary

Graveside services for Hazel L. Stewart, 91, Lawrence, will be held at 2:00 p.m. Monday, January 24, 2022, at Oak Hill Cemetery in Lawrence, KS. Hazel passed away on Monday, January 17, 2022, at LMH Health.

Per Douglas County and the family of Hazel Stewart, masks are required to be worn at the visitation and burial.

Hazel was born on April 25, 1930, in Lawrence, KS, the daughter of William and Nannie (Howard) Sinks.

She was longtime waitress at the original Drakes Bakery that was on Mass St. She has many happy memories of her coworkers & the customers they served. She later worked for the SRS as a Family Support Worker. She retired after 19 years of service.

She married Daryl "Bill" Stewart on August 14, 1948, in Leavenworth, KS. He preceded her in death in 1978.

Survivors include her daughter, Barbara Stewart Brown, son, Blaine (Janet) Stewart, brother, Lawrence Sinks, two grandchildren, Joey (Patti Roberts) Wilson, Jeremy (Marsha) Wilson, two great-grandchildren, Allison Giago-Wilson, Jake Wilson, and one great great-granddaughter, Eloise Giago-Wilson.

Hazel was preceded in death by her parents, brother, Charles Sinks, and sister, Mildred Sinks-Spence.

Hazel loved going to garage sales, eating Morel mushrooms & watching the Jayhawks play. She was a loving person whose family was the most important thing in the world to her. She had a lot of spirit & many good times were spent with her.
